@fahadshakeel
It's an error with FR24.
SMK is usually the callsign for local military aircraft.
However, sometimes due to ModeS or HexCode similarities, one aircraft can show up as another on their site. It has happened before as well.
I remember a few months ago, I noticed it was showing an EK B777 doing domestic flights in USA.

SMK is generally displayed against army/airforce Super Mushaak acft. If you play the flight, you can see the GS around 125-130 and cruise alt of 5500 feet on out bound leg and 6500 feed on in bound. Most probably it is a super Mushaak. How it got linked to an EK A380, remains a mystery.
